Team Manuel celebrates after capturing the Nova Scotia Tankard at the Bluenose Curling Club in New Glasgow on Monday. From left are coach Kevin Patterson, skip Matthew Manuel third Luke Saunders and lead Nick Zachernuk. Missing is second Jeff Meagher. - Adam MacInnisMatthew Manuel was not about to let a great week of curling go up in smoke.

Manuel and his team of third Luke Saunders, second Jeff Meagher and lead Nick Zachernuk stole a single in the 10th end for the win. On Sunday night, the Mayflower crew surrendered steals in the 10th and 11th ends to allow Purcell to force the Monday showdown."We were right in the position we wanted. By winning the two qualifier games, we knew that we’d still have our hammer and choice of rocks coming into this final game.

"It’s unreal," said Manuel."We played so well this week. We had so much belief in this team. We practised so hard.”
